◎研究方向 | ||||||
[1] 有机场效应晶体管稳定性机制及策略研究; [2] 有机场效应晶体管的器件设计与集成; [3] 人工智能赋能有机光电功能器件设计与优化(AI for Chemistry); | ||||||
